More money, more problems

​You recently received some birthday money, $130 to be exact. You count the number of bills you have and find that you have 17 bills, all either $10 or $5 bills.

How many of each bill do you have?​

Hint: Just try guessing and checking first!

45

How does this have to do with math?

Sometimes, in math, we are asked for two answers, like how many $5 bills AND $10 bills. Systems of equations are how we solve these problems.

46

You've lost me...

Systems of equations are two or more equations that have the same variables like:​

y=x+1

y=-2x+6​

which both have x and y​

47

Systems of Equations

Systems of equations are used when we are given two pieces of information and asked for two answers from it, like our first question.

48

media

Solutions are where two lines intersect on a graph and these are our answers.

The solution here is (-1,3) because that is where the lines intersect!​

Solutions=answers
